Not an Olds related subject, but I have a question

Hi, I am fairly new to this forum and recently posted a thread in the parts wanted section. My post was answered by someone who claimed that they had the parts I needed and would sell them to me. However, the person did not have photos, could not describe the parts and wanted payment via Western Union. I quickly realized that the person was trying to scam me and I did not go any further with him. I am trying to find out if this is a common problem among these posts and how I can report this type of scam attempt? Any Ideas?

Common problem with all these message boards.The scammers search the want ads and reply to the parties interested in obtaining something hoping they can make a quick and easy buck by ripping someone off.
Whenever I place an ad for parts wanted,on any board,not just here.I always get some blokes from overseas responding,claiming to have the part and wanting my money.
Personally,I only deal with people who are regular and long time posters of the board I am visiting.People with a known reputation. If I do deal with someone who is unknown or kindy risky sounding...I tell them they have to send the part first,then I will pay.
